
基于ASP+Access的校园学生管理系统功能展示

根据提供的信息,该知识点主要涉及ASP(Active Server Pages)编程语言和Microsoft Access数据库管理系统。此外,还涉及到学生管理系统的设计和功能实现,以及如何将Dota游戏元素融入到系统背景中。以下是对这些知识点的详细阐述:
### 1. ASP(Active Server Pages)技术
ASP是一种服务器端脚本环境,用于创建交互式网页。它允许开发者将HTML网页和脚本命令混合在一起,从而动态生成网页内容。ASP脚本是用VBScript(一种类似于Visual Basic的编程语言)或者JavaScript编写的,它运行在服务器上,用户访问网页时,服务器处理脚本代码,然后发送结果到用户的浏览器。
ASP的主要特点包括:
- **服务器端执行**:代码在服务器上运行,减轻了客户端的负担。
- **易于使用**:ASP与HTML集成,允许开发者快速创建动态网页。
- **数据库交互**:ASP可以轻松地与数据库交互,执行查询和数据管理操作。
- **跨平台兼容性**:ASP代码可以在多种服务器软件和操作系统上运行。
### 2. Microsoft Access数据库
Access是一个桌面数据库管理系统,由Microsoft推出,用于存储和管理数据。它被广泛用于小型至中型应用程序中。Access数据库文件通常具有“.mdb”或“.accdb”扩展名。
Access的主要特点包括:
- **用户友好界面**:提供了易于使用的图形用户界面,方便创建和管理数据库。
- **数据处理**:具有表、查询、窗体、报表、宏和模块等多种数据库对象,可以用来管理数据。
- **SQL支持**:支持SQL(Structured Query Language)语句进行数据操作,可以实现复杂的查询和数据管理。
- **集成性**:能够与Microsoft Office套件等其他应用程序集成,方便数据导入导出。
### 3. 学生管理系统功能实现
系统中提到的各个功能模块是学生管理系统的关键组成部分,主要包括:
- **学生登录与注册**:允许学生通过输入用户名和密码登录系统,并提供注册功能,使新学生能够创建账户。
- **公告分页**:系统可以发布通知公告,并通过分页技术,将长公告内容分割显示,便于用户浏览。
- **学籍信息管理**:可以录入、修改、查询和展示学生的学籍信息。
- **学生选课系统**:允许学生浏览课程信息,并根据自己的需求选择想要参加的课程。
- **成绩查询**:学生可以查询自己已有的成绩记录。
- **课表查询**:为学生提供个人课表查询功能,可以查看自己在一段时间内的课程安排。
### 4. DotA背景素材的使用
本系统以DotA(Defense of the Ancients)为背景素材,DotA是一款流行的多人在线战斗竞技游戏。在学生管理系统中使用DotA的素材,可能意味着系统的界面设计、角色、技能等方面会与游戏相关,这为系统增添了趣味性和吸引力。例如,系统中的角色可以采用DotA游戏中的英雄形象,技能得分可以比喻为游戏中的击杀积分等。
### 5. 开发技术与工具
为了实现上述系统功能,开发者需要熟悉如下技术与工具:
- **HTML/CSS**:用于创建和设计网页的结构和样式。
- **VBScript 或 JavaScript**:编写ASP后端脚本。
- **SQL**:编写数据库查询和维护语句。
- **Access 数据库操作**:掌握如何创建表、视图、查询和报表等。
- **Visual Basic 或其他编程语言**(可选):如果系统需要更复杂的逻辑处理,可能会使用其他语言编写组件或模块。
### 结论
综上所述,"asp+access学生管理系统"是一个采用ASP脚本语言和Access数据库构建的系统,它涵盖了学生管理的多个基本功能,并通过引入DotA元素增加了系统的趣味性和用户黏性。开发者需要具备ASP开发、Access数据库管理和前端设计的技术知识,才能顺利完成该系统的设计与实现。
相关推荐







sangx8
- 粉丝: 0
最新资源
- BBS发帖管理系统及管理工具
- 构建面向服务的花店公司Web平台
- 全面掌握Oracle 9i:体系结构、编程与管理
- 深入了解Servlet代码:课堂内部实践解析
- 综合驱动开发与调试工具包:打造高效PCI驱动环境
- 基于STC89C52设计的线通检测器工程实践
- 深入理解TServerSocket和TClientSocket类在JSocket包中的应用
- CCS DSP开发中文教程:C语言编程指南
- 《C语言也能干大事》第十五节:深入SQL语句编程
- 使用appface VC皮肤插件美化MFC程序简易教程
- 精通curses编程:20个大类与实例游戏程序详解
- 三菱FX2N-20GM运动控制编程软件介绍
- 彻底清理微软软件残留:Windows安装清理工具v2.05
- 毕业设计辅导:VB图书管理系统全套资料
- PHP入门:构建简易文章发布系统
- MySQL数据库表结构导出至Word文档工具介绍
- PHP中文分词工具包:实现精准搜索算法
- Apache Tomcat 7.0.6 for Windows x86平台安装指南
- 计算机三级网络基础讲义第二章要点
- STM32实现LCD驱动芯片DDS9951控制技巧
- C#实现商场信息系统的数据管理与更新
- JSP图书管理系统实现增删改查功能
- DXP2004A/D原理图库件应用指南
- C#使用VSTO实现授权部署程序的方法